▼Job Responsibilities
This job involves working on utility poles and power lines to deliver electricity to homes and businesses!
▼ Main Job Responsibilities
・Erect a new utility pole
・Stringing power lines between utility poles
・Install transformers on utility poles to supply electricity to homes, businesses, and other locations
・Replacing or relocating aging utility poles, power lines, transformers, and other equipment
It's a job essential to daily life—ensuring everyone can use electricity safely every day!
